On Tue, October 24, 2006 9:46 am, Erwin Van de Velde wrote:
> Hi all,
>
> This is an error in the compilation of icu and has been reported a couple
> of weeks ago... It would be nice if someone found the time to look into
> this as it indeed blocks multiple updates on many systems.

So folks are specifically aware -- glib20 will install fine *if* the
collation fix is unselected.  icu is only a dependency for the collation
fix.
